    Visa Poaches Aida Diarra From Western Union, Appoints Her Senior Vice President

    Visa has announced Aida Diarra as Senior Vice President and Group Country Manager for Visa Sub-Saharan Africa, effective November 1, 2018.

    Aida joins Visa from Western Union, where she was the Regional Vice President for Africa & Managing Director for more than four years.

    Diarra will oversee all Visa operations in forty-eight markets across Sub-Saharan Africa. She will report to Visa’s Regional President of Central and Eastern Europe, Middle East and Africa (CEMEA), Andrew Torre, and join CEMEA regional management team.

    Prior to her position at Western Union, she held a number of leadership positions at the global money transfer business in marketing, sales, account management, strategy & planning.

    “Sub-Saharan Africa is a region of incredible opportunity – there will be more than 1500 million mobile subscribers by 2020, but many countries lack payments acceptance and infrastructure. Within the next several years an additional 55 million people in this region will be new to the banking system, and so continuing to invest in partnerships that connect these new consumers and merchants to great connected-commerce experiences, is critical for sustained and inclusive economic growth,” said Andrew Torre, Regional President, CEMEA, for Visa.

    As part of Visa CEMEA’s regional management team, Aida will also represent Sub-Saharan Africa within the regional and global Visa network.
